The Secret Language Everyone Speaks
Right now, you're fluent in a language nobody ever taught you. A glance, a step backward, a band t-shirt, a "seen" with no reply — humans are constantly sending and reading signals we never say out loud. In this episode, Whammy walks into a room where no one is speaking… and discovers everyone is already talking. We unpack the secret language everyone speaks: how your face broadcasts messages before you choose a single word, why standing too close causes instant chaos, how the objects in your room introduce you before you say hello, the invisible status signals inside every group, and why even silence — and a message left on read — says something. It's the oldest language humans ever spoke: older than writing, older than technology, older than words. And once you see it… you can't stop noticing it.
